Figuring Out Your Hair Type
In what manner can one accurately determine their hair type? Comprehending hair type begins with observing its texture, thickness, and curl pattern. Hair is divided into straight, wavy, curly, or coily, with each type further divided based on thickness—fine, medium, or coarse. To evaluate this, individuals should analyze a single piece of hair. Fine hair feels sleek and gentle, while coarse hair is thicker and more resilient. In addition, the curl pattern can be distinguished by paying attention to how hair behaves when dry. Straight hair lies flat, wavy hair makes gentle bends, curly hair produces distinct curls, and coily hair coils tightly. This foundational knowledge aids in choosing suitable styling and maintenance techniques tailored to specific hair types.
Fundamental Materials For Support
Selecting the right products designed for one’s hair type can noticeably enhance its condition and visual appeal. For fine hair, delicate shampoos and volumizing conditioners are recommended to avoid weighing it down. Medium hair benefits from proportioned products that supply moisture without extra heaviness. Curly or textured hair often requires hydrating shampoos and luxurious conditioners to sustain moisture and minimize frizz. Those with thick hair may find that creamy or oil-based products help control volume and boost shine. Additionally, color-treated hair needs sulfate-free shampoos and color-protecting conditioners to maintain vibrancy. Lastly, incorporating leave-in treatments or serums can provide extra nourishment and protection, ensuring that each hair type stays healthy and resilient.
Styling Approaches For Each
Crafting the perfect hairstyle often copyrights on using the right methods suited to each hair type. For straight hair, smooth styling implements and smoothing serums produce a polished look. Wavy hair gains from texturizing sprays to boost natural waves while maintaining volume. Curly hair requires moisture-rich creams and diffusing methods to define curls without frizz. For coily hair, protective styles and heavier oils help maintain hydration and reduce breakage. Fine hair flourishes with volumizing products and lightweight styling gels to prevent limpness. Thick hair often needs stronger hold products and heat protectants to manage its weight. By understanding these tailored techniques, individuals can boost their hair's potential and achieve their desired styles effectively.

Timeline for Consultations
Clients should schedule their hair appointments for special occasions with careful timing. Timing is essential for attaining the desired look. Experts suggest booking appointments at least four to six weeks ahead to guarantee stylists can fulfill specific requests. This timeframe allows for consultations and necessary adjustments. For special events such as weddings or proms, a trial run is recommended, ideally booked two to three weeks before. This process helps clients visualize their final style and make any necessary changes. Moreover, clients should consider the time of day for their appointment; early morning slots often provide a relaxed environment, while evening appointments may be busier. In general, planning ahead guarantees a smooth experience and a flawless hairstyle on the big day.
